배열관련해서 질문좀 드릴게요~
츠키코
2023.04.01
질문 제목 : 배열관련해서 질문좀 드릴게요~배열관련해서 질문좀 드릴게요~질문 내용 :
일단 아래 관련 소스에 질문이 있습니다.
아래에 보시면 빨간색으로 된 부분에 대한 소스부분을
이해가 되지 않습니다.
str[i] 이부분에서 왜 괄호안에 변수 i 라는게 있고 어떻게 쓰이는지..
str[4-i] 왜 str이라는 배열에 괄호안에 4-i를 왜 빼는지,..
빨간색으로 된부분 전체적으로 이해가 되지않습니다.
빨간부분에 주석처리해서 설명좀 부탁드리겠습니다.
갈수록 어렵네요 ㅠㅠ
------------------------------------------------------------------------
#include stdio.h
int main(void)
{
int i;
char ch;
char str[6]=hello;
printf(--변경 전 문자열 --\n);
printf(%s \n, str);
for(i=0; i6; i++)
printf(%c |, str[i]);
//문자열 변경
for(i=0; i3; i++)
{
ch=str[4-i];
str[4-i]=str[i];
str[i]=ch;
}
printf(\n\n--변경 후 문자열--\n);
printf(%s \n, str);
}
-------------------------------------------------------------------------------------